Lockheed Martin: A Pillar of Defense Industry Reliability
Lockheed Martin, a global leader in defense manufacturing, stands as a quintessential blue-chip enterprise. The persistent global demand for advanced weaponry, aircraft, and related technologies ensures a consistent revenue stream for the company. Its involvement in major defense programs, such as the F-35 Lightning II fighter jet, underscores its critical role and long-term financial stability. Despite recent market movements, the company's substantial order backlog and projected earnings growth make it an attractive prospect for investors seeking both capital appreciation and dividend income.
Deere & Co.: Cultivating Growth in Agriculture and Beyond
Deere & Co., distinguished by its iconic John Deere brand, is a dominant force in the agricultural, forestry, and construction equipment sectors. The company's diversified business model, including its significant financial services division, positions it strongly within essential global industries. While agricultural markets can be cyclical, leading to periodic fluctuations in performance, Deere's enduring market presence, technological innovation in autonomous machinery, and analysts' optimistic earnings projections indicate significant recovery and growth potential during industry upturns. Investing in Deere during a temporary slump aligns with a strategy of capitalizing on cyclical recovery.
